It already uses COMPILE_TEST:

config SPI_SPRD_ADI
	tristate "Spreadtrum ADI controller"
	depends on ARCH_SPRD || COMPILE_TEST
	help
	  ADI driver based on SPI for Spreadtrum SoCs.

but that allows build errors when SPI_SPRD_ADI=y and HWSPINLOCK=y.

As for the dependency that I am adding:
+	depends on HWSPINLOCK || HWSPINLOCK=n

that idiom is used over and over again in Kconfig files to prevent this kind of
build problem in loadable modules.
